So, i overclocked my 4670k at 4.2 GHz at 1.2Vcore. I tested stability with intel burn test and it passes. Now im doing the 3dmark firestrike benchmark and i get a bsod. Isnt this weird as itb is much more demanding? I reduced clock speed to 4 GHz and now it passes the bechmark fine.

Presumably Win8? I had gotten the same error when my overclock apparently became unstable after being 1yr WCG-stable. A 100mhz drop did the trick and made those nasties go bye bye.

Ibt is very specific in what part of the cpu it hits. But what it does hit it hits really hard. I once had a cpu pass xtu cpu test(basically ibt) and crash in a blender render which didn't even cause that much vdroop. Ever since then I just spam run 5 blender renders in the background of my interneting for stability testing instead of ibt or similar software.
